This book has been sitting on my bookshelf for a few years and I finally decided to finish the rest of it. It really is a great resource to improve communication skills in a variety of contexts whether close interpersonal relationships or in professional work settings.
The contents include
Basic skills (listening, self-disclosure, expressing)
Advanced Skills (Body Language, Paralanguage/Metamessages, Hidden Agendas, Transactional Analysis, Clarifying Language, Culture and Gender)
Conflict Skills (Assertiveness Training, Fair Fighting, Negotiation)
Social Skills (Prejudgment, Making Contact)
Family Skills (Sexual Communication, Communicating with Children, Family Communication)
Public Skills (Influencing Others, Small groups, Public Speaking, Interviewing)
Chapters are easy to follow and McKay, Davis, & Fanning provide plenty of exercises. Communication is an essential, but overlooked skill to have in a social world and anyone would benefit from the contents of this book.
